■Part1: Resident status required to start a business or work in Japan

▼Contents

We will explain the status of residence required for foreigners to work or conduct business in Japan, dividing it into several cases. For example, we will look at how the status of residence differs when an individual foreigner establishes a company, when a foreign company establishes a subsidiary, and when a foreigner works for an existing company. Among other things, we plan to take a closer look at the business management visa.

■Part2 : Basic knowledge of skills-based hiring in Japan

▼Contents
Firstly, we will talk about the difference between skills-based hiring and the traditional Japanese way of hiring. Next, we will explain basic knowledge of dismissal in Japan and then how to consider dismissal of an employee hired by skills-based.
